Parker-Hannifin (PH) Net Income towards Common Stockholders (2009 - 2026)
Parker-Hannifin (PH) reported Net Income towards Common Stockholders of $904.0 million for Q1 2026, down 5.93% year-over-year from $961.0 million in Q1 2025, and up 6.98% quarter-over-quarter from $845.0 million in Q4 2025.
